I want to wish everyone a happy new year! But you say, Ron, January 1st was months ago. True, but March 20th was the first day of spring, the first day of Aries, and the first day of the new zodiacal year in astrology. And March 26th is the new moon in Aries, so we're truly at the beginning of the beginning.
The March new moon occurs at 6 degrees of Aries around noon (EDT) on March 26, 2009. Looking at the chart for the new moon we find four planets in fire signs (the Sun, Moon, Venus and Mercury are all in Aries) and five planets in cardinal signs (all the Aries planets plus Pluto in Capricorn). Cardinal signs begin the seasons and their purpose is to initiate or start things.
The energy mix of this new monthly cycle is cardinal fire- Aries. The element of fire in astrology is a symbol for energy, inspriation, spirit, fuel, and motivation. Cardinal fire then is like a flame thrower or a fuse- a direct and expedient path to energetic expression.
Aries is associated with beginnings, just like the beginning of spring when life seems to reappear after the cold, barren winter. Aries is the life force that announces, "I'm here," and tends to be very self-focused.
The planet that rules Aries in astrology is Mars. Mars in mythology was the god of war and represents the warrior in all of us. Mars is a very male-oriented energy, fueled by testosterone, and tends to be aggressive, dynamic, impulsive and courageous. Mars is currently in the sign of Pisces and encourages us to act from our intuition.
While every new moon is the start of a new cycle and a time to set new intentions and begin new habits, the new moon in Aries is especially strong. It's a time to exercise self-discovery, independence, and act courageously in every endeavor you take on... Continue reading New Moon in Aries
"Did I pass the Florida Bar Exam, that I took in February, results are expected on April 13th, and I am dying to know?" - Matt
Thanks for submitting your question, Matt. In order to answer this question using astrology I'm going to look at two charts. The first is a horary chart, cast for the date and time I, as the astrologer, received and understood your question. The reason I chose this type of chart is because your question can be answered with a simple yes or no. Then, I also looked at your natal chart, cast for the birth date and time you supplied. I did that to confirm the answer I believe the horary chart is giving. Read the answer to this question
"I am a 48 year old male. I read in my computer purchased (on-line) transitory chart that I have Chiron square coming up in April 2010- Dec 2011. In doing some research this claims to be a part in my life where I will expect some limititions that have to do with my loss of mind/body/life/soul. I just started to learn about astrology. I have a new born grandson. Does this mean something bad is going to happen to me like death/bad accident, where I will never be able to be myself again? I am really freaking out to the point that I am scared of everything." -Jim
Jim, I'm sorry to hear you're feeling so anxious about what you've read about Chiron. It's important to remember that astrology is good a two things: the timing of events and the description of circumstances. That second point, put another way, is that astrology is good at describing conditions not outcomes. Astrology is a symbolic language and gives us concepts to use in understanding ourselves.
